Major Characters

The Wife is a young American woman traveling in Italy with her husband, George. Feeling isolated in her hotel room, she longs for traditional feminine comforts, such as long hair, her own silver, new clothes, and a pet to nurture. Her unarticulated desires manifest as a sudden fixation on rescuing a stray cat sheltering from the rain outside her window.

George is an American tourist spending a rainy afternoon reading in his hotel room in Italy. He approaches his marriage casually and pays little attention to his wife's growing dissatisfaction. He prefers his wife's hair short and remains content as long as his reading goes uninterrupted, failing to offer his wife real support or an umbrella when she decides to go outside.

Supporting Characters

The Hotel-Keeper, or padrone, is an older, tall Italian man with a dignified presence who manages the hotel where the American couple stays. He takes his business seriously and goes out of his way to make his guests feel cared for. His attentive, fatherly nature provides a sharp contrast to George's indifference.

The Maid works at the Italian hotel where the American couple is staying. Following the Hotel-Keeper's instructions, she attends to the wife's needs, holding an umbrella over her in the rain and fetching things for the room. Her dutiful actions provide the wife with a brief moment of care and personal connection.
